1. Top Speed

The maximum speed of an under desk treadmill folding is a major factor to be considered. The majority of these treadmills are restricted to speeds of less than 5 mph. This means that walking on a treadmill will seem more like a leisurely stroll than sweaty exercise. This may not be a problem for some people, but if looking to get an intense cardio workout in between Zoom meetings, this kind of device isn't the best choice for you.

2. Noise

While treadmills at the desk are fantastic for boosting your movement at work and providing an increase in health, they can also produce a lot of noise. Some models are quieter than others. If you plan to use your under desk treadmill in a shared space it is essential to think about the amount of noise it will make. In addition, the type of flooring that you put under your treadmill can affect the volume of noise it creates. Hard floors, like can increase the sound. This can be a nuisance to other employees.

The sound generated by an under desk treadmill will depend on the speed at which it is operated. For instance, if you walk at a fast pace the sound level could be similar to the sound of a toilet flushing or vacuuming. However, the noise level will decrease when you reduce the speed.

The majority of treadmills under desks are motorized, and a few of them have an integrated desktop that helps to keep the noise levels to a minimum. Some models also have acoustic insulation installed under the belt to reduce the noise level.

There are many options for under-desk treadmills but you'll need to keep a few things in mind when choosing one. Stability and maximum capacity for weight are two important aspects to take into consideration. Under-desk treadmills tend to be less stable and have lower weight capacities than regular fitness treadmills. This can cause problems particularly for those who are overweight or plan to use the treadmill for the course of a long time.

You'll also need to think about how easy it is to store your treadmill underneath your desk when you're not using it. There are plenty of options that make this process as easy as it can be. The REDLIRO is a good example, since it comes with a desktop attachment that can be adjusted to fit your current standing desk height. You can fold the handrails up and store them under your desk or next to the wall.

Other models, such as the UREVO are designed to fold down into an extremely compact box that can be tucked neatly under tables or other furniture. They are ideal for those who want an all-year-round solution. They can be tucked out of sight when not being used. These models are heavier than other treadmills under desks but they also come with wheels, making them easier to move around if you have to.

Some treadmills under desks also come with a remote control and LED screens that display speed, distance, time and more, allowing you to monitor your progress and encourage you to keep going. Others, such as the GOPLUS, are affordable and simple enough to use straight out of the box.

One treadmill under the desk that we like is the UREVO 2-in-1. It's not the most powerful treadmill however at less than $370 on Amazon it's a great choice for those looking to keep their spending affordable and still squeeze in some exercise during their working hours. The model folds on itself and is easy to store when not in use.

Another good choice is the WalkingPad P1. The machine folds into half and stored under a desk, or against a wall. It includes a remote as well as an LED screen that helps you keep track of your fitness goals and the progress you've made. It's heavier than other models we have tested, weighing at 62 pounds. However, it has wheels on the bottom that make it easier to move around.

The 180 degree folding design makes it easy to place under your sofa, desk or your bed. Its light weight and 180-degree folding design makes it easy to store. It comes with a heavy weight limit, and a stylish digital display that shows your steps as well as distance, time, calories burned and other information. All WalkingPad treadmills that are under desks are covered by a one-year warranty, which will ease your concerns about the quality.
